飛彈彈頭市場

受巡航飛彈和彈道飛彈市場機會的推動,全球飛彈彈頭市場前景光明。預計2026年至2035年,全球飛彈彈頭市場將以5.6%的複合年成長率成長,到2035年市場規模預計將達到250億美元。該市場的主要成長要素包括對戰術飛彈彈頭的需求不斷成長、對先進防禦系統的投資增加以及對軍事戰備日益重視。

  • 根據 Lucintel 的預測,由於全球對常規彈頭的需求不斷成長,預計常規彈頭在預測期內將呈現最高的成長率。
  • 按產品類型,由於精確打擊能力和遠程打擊能力的提高,巡航飛彈預計將呈現更高的成長率。
  • 從區域來看,在預測期內,北美預計將呈現最高的成長率,這主要得益於其先進的國防基礎設施和軍事支出。

飛彈彈頭市場的新發展

飛彈彈頭市場正經歷快速發展,其驅動力包括技術進步、地緣政治格局變化以及全球國防預算的不斷成長。隨著各國軍事能力的提升,創新設計和戰略考量正在塑造飛彈彈頭的未來。這些趨勢促使人們不僅關注精準度和殺傷力的提升,也更重視隱藏性、多功能性和成本效益。區域衝突、現代化專案以及先進材料和電子技術的整合也對市場成長產生影響。對於希望保持競爭力並適應瞬息萬變的國防環境的相關人員,了解這些新興趨勢至關重要。

  • 技術創新:彈頭技術正取得顯著進步,包括精確導引飛彈、高超音速飛彈和多模式彈頭。這些創新提高了目標精度,減少了附帶損害,並增強了作戰效能。智慧電子設備和先進感測器的整合實現了即時目標修正,使彈頭能夠更好地適應複雜的作戰環境。隨著技術的進步,研發重點轉向開發更輕、更有效率的彈頭,使其能夠從多種飛彈平台發射,從而拓展國防部隊的戰略選擇。
  • 超音速彈頭:高超音速彈頭的研發是當前的主要趨勢,其驅動力在於需要能夠突破先進飛彈防禦網路的高速、高機動性飛彈系統。這些彈頭的飛行速度超過5馬赫,能夠顯著縮短敵方反應時間,並提高攻擊成功的機率。各國正大力投資研發高超音速滑翔飛行器和助推滑翔系統。這正在顯著改變戰略阻礙力和進攻能力,並加速區域和全球軍備競賽。
  • 區域地緣政治因素:地緣政治緊張局勢和區域衝突正在推動對先進飛彈彈頭的需求。亞太地區、中東和東歐各國正在對其武器系統進行現代化改造,以應對區域威脅。這一趨勢導致遠程高精度彈頭的採購量增加,以及各國發展國內飛彈項目。因此,市場競爭日益激烈,各國都力圖透過先進的飛彈技術來建立戰略優勢和阻礙力,這正在影響全球國防採購模式和聯盟關係。
  • 隱身與生存能力的重要性日益凸顯:現代飛彈彈頭的設計越來越注重隱身性能,以避免偵測和攔截。小雷達反射面積、電子對抗措施和誘餌系統提高了飛彈在部署過程中的生存能力。這一趨勢的驅動力在於先進飛彈防禦系統的擴散,這些系統需要能夠穿透多層防禦的彈頭。因此,飛彈系統正朝著更複雜、更難攔截的方向發展,這顯著改變了戰場動態,並影響各國軍隊的現代化戰略。
  • 經濟高效的模組化設計:隨著國防預算的波動,開發經濟高效的模組化彈頭系統變得日益重要。此類設計便於客製化、維護和升級,從而降低全壽命週期成本。模組化彈頭可適配各種飛彈平台和任務類型,提升作戰柔軟性。這一趨勢正在推動各國和非國家行為體更廣泛地採用飛彈技術,影響市場競爭,並刺激製造流程和材料的創新。

這些新趨勢正透過技術能力的進步、戰略多樣性的增強以及對地緣政治壓力和國防預算限制的應對,從根本上改變飛彈彈頭市場。市場正朝著更聰明、更快速、生存能力更強的彈頭方向發展,這正在重新定義現代戰爭和戰略威懾的範式。

飛彈彈頭市場近期趨勢

飛彈彈頭市場正經歷快速發展,其驅動力包括技術創新、地緣政治緊張局勢以及不斷成長的全球國防預算。這些趨勢正在塑造導彈技術的未來,並為國防機構和製造商創造新的機會。隨著各國努力增強戰略能力,市場在精確導引頭、高超音速技術和飛彈防禦系統等多個領域都呈現顯著成長。這種瞬息萬變的環境凸顯了創新和戰略夥伴關係關係在維護軍事優勢方面的重要性。

  • 精確導引頭的需求日益成長:隨著飛彈攻擊對精準度要求的不斷提高,先進精確導引頭的研發正在加速推進。這些彈頭能夠提高打擊目標的精確度,減少附帶損害,並提升作戰效率。世界各國政府都在大力投資這些技術以應對不斷演變的威脅,從而推動了研發活動的激增。 GPS、紅外線和雷射導引系統的整合使這些彈頭的效能更高,並促使其在全球各種軍事平台上得到更廣泛的應用。
  • 高超音速飛彈技術進展:能夠以超過5馬赫的速度飛行的高超音速飛彈正在徹底改變飛彈戰爭的模式。近期發展包括新型推進系統和材料,都使得高超音速飛彈能夠持續飛行。這些進步帶來了許多戰略優勢,例如縮短反應時間和提升突破飛彈防禦系統的能力。各國都在積極投資高超音速飛彈研究,預計將對全球軍事平衡產生重大影響,並引發新一輪飛彈技術軍備競賽。
  • 飛彈防禦系統擴展:彈道飛彈和巡航飛彈威脅日益加劇,加速了先進飛彈防禦系統的部署。近期創新成果包括多層防禦架構、先進雷達系統以及射程和精度更高的攔截飛彈。這些系統對於保護關鍵基礎設施和軍事資產至關重要。各國政府正優先建造一體化防禦網路,預計將提升威脅偵測能力、攔截成功率和整體國家安全,並最終推動飛彈彈頭市場的擴張。
  • 將人工智慧(AI)整合到導彈系統中,透過賦予導彈更聰明、更自主的目標捕獲和決策能力,正在改變導彈彈頭技術。近期發展包括用於威脅評估和自適應目標捕獲的機器學習演算法。這提高了導彈精度,縮短了響應時間,並最大限度地減少了人為錯誤。國防機構正在擴大人工智慧驅動系統的應用,以提高作戰效率和戰場效能,預計將顯著推動飛彈彈頭市場成長,並促進飛彈設計領域的創新。
  • 潛射彈頭日益受到關注:潛射飛彈系統因其戰略機動性和生存能力而日益重要。近期技術進步包括彈頭小型化、隱身性能提升和射程延長。這些進步使潛艦能夠作為可靠的輔助打擊平台,確保阻礙力的穩定性。各國正在投資潛射飛彈技術,以增強其核打擊和常規打擊能力,預計將擴大潛射彈頭及相關系統的市場。

精確導引頭、高超音速技術、飛彈防禦系統、人工智慧整合以及潛射彈頭等領域的最新進展,正為飛彈彈頭市場帶來重大變革。這些創新提升了戰略能力,增加了國防費用,並刺激了國際競爭。隨著各國將先進飛彈技術列為優先事項,在技術創新、地緣政治因素以及提升國家安全需求的推動下,飛彈彈頭市場預計將顯著成長。

Missile Warhead Market

The future of the global missile warhead market looks promising with opportunities in the cruise missile and ballistic missile markets. The global missile warhead market is expected to reach an estimated $25 billion by 2035 with a CAGR of 5.6% from 2026 to 2035. The major drivers for this market are the increasing demand for tactical missile warheads, the rising investments in advanced defense systems, and the growing emphasis on military combat readiness.

  • Lucintel forecasts that, within the warhead category, conventional warhead is expected to witness the highest growth over the forecast period due to the increasing demand for conventional warheads globally
  • Within the product category, cruise missile is expected to witness higher growth due to the rising precision strike and long range capabilities.
  • In terms of regions, North America is expected to witness the highest growth over the forecast period due to the advanced defense infrastructure and military spending

Emerging Trends in Missile Warhead Market

The missile warhead market is experiencing rapid evolution driven by technological advancements, geopolitical shifts, and increasing defense budgets worldwide. As nations seek to enhance their military capabilities, innovative designs and strategic considerations are shaping the future landscape of missile warheads. These developments are not only improving accuracy and lethality but also emphasizing stealth, versatility, and cost-effectiveness. The markets growth is also influenced by regional conflicts, modernization programs, and the integration of advanced materials and electronics. Understanding these emerging trends is crucial for stakeholders aiming to stay competitive and adapt to the dynamic defense environment.

  • Technological Innovation: The market is witnessing significant advancements in warhead technology, including precision-guided munitions, hypersonic capabilities, and multi-mode warheads. These innovations improve targeting accuracy, reduce collateral damage, and enhance operational effectiveness. The integration of smart electronics and advanced sensors allows for real-time targeting adjustments, making warheads more adaptable to complex combat scenarios. As technology progresses, the focus is on developing lighter, more efficient warheads that can be deployed from a variety of missile platforms, thereby expanding strategic options for defense forces.
  • Hypersonic Warheads: The development of hypersonic warheads is a major trend, driven by the need for rapid, highly maneuverable missile systems capable of penetrating advanced missile defenses. These warheads travel at speeds exceeding Mach 5, drastically reducing the time for enemy response and increasing the likelihood of successful strikes. Countries are investing heavily in research and development to create hypersonic glide vehicles and boost-glide systems. The impact is a significant shift in strategic deterrence and offensive capabilities, prompting regional and global arms race dynamics.
  • Regional Geopolitical Influences: Geopolitical tensions and regional conflicts are fueling demand for advanced missile warheads. Countries in Asia-Pacific, the Middle East, and Eastern Europe are modernizing their arsenals to counterbalance regional threats. This trend leads to increased procurement of long-range, high-precision warheads and the development of indigenous missile programs. The market is thus becoming more competitive, with nations seeking to achieve strategic dominance and deterrence through superior missile technology, influencing global defense procurement patterns and alliances.
  • Focus on Stealth and Survivability: Modern missile warheads are increasingly designed with stealth features to evade detection and interception. Low radar cross-section designs, electronic countermeasures, and decoy systems enhance survivability during deployment. This trend is driven by the proliferation of advanced missile defense systems, necessitating warheads that can penetrate layered defenses. The impact is a shift towards more sophisticated, hard-to-intercept missile systems, which significantly alter battlefield dynamics and force modernization strategies across military forces.
  • Cost-Effective and Modular Designs: As defense budgets fluctuate, there is a growing emphasis on developing cost-effective, modular warhead systems. These designs allow for easier customization, maintenance, and upgrades, reducing lifecycle costs. Modular warheads can be adapted for different missile platforms and mission profiles, increasing operational flexibility. This trend supports the proliferation of missile technology among a broader range of countries and non-state actors, influencing market competition and encouraging innovation in manufacturing processes and materials.

These emerging trends are fundamentally reshaping the missile warhead market by enhancing technological capabilities, increasing strategic versatility, and responding to geopolitical and defense budget pressures. The market is moving towards smarter, faster, and more survivable warheads, which are redefining modern warfare and strategic deterrence paradigms.

Missile Warhead Market Drivers and Challenges

The missile warhead market is influenced by a complex interplay of technological advancements, economic considerations, and regulatory frameworks. Rapid developments in missile technology, geopolitical tensions, and defense budgets significantly shape market dynamics. Additionally, international treaties and export controls impact the development and deployment of missile warheads. The evolving threat landscape necessitates continuous innovation, while economic factors such as government spending and defense budgets determine market growth. Regulatory challenges, including compliance with international agreements, also influence market operations. Understanding these drivers and challenges is essential for stakeholders aiming to navigate this highly sensitive and strategic industry effectively.

The factors responsible for driving the missile warhead market include:-

  • Technological Innovation: Rapid advancements in missile technology, including precision targeting and payload capabilities, drive market growth by enabling more effective defense systems. Governments and defense contractors invest heavily in R&D to develop next-generation warheads, which enhances strategic deterrence and operational effectiveness. These innovations also open new markets for advanced missile systems, fostering competition and technological leadership. As threats evolve, so does the need for sophisticated warheads, making innovation a key driver for sustained market expansion.
  • Geopolitical Tensions and Defense Spending: Increasing geopolitical tensions and regional conflicts prompt nations to bolster their missile arsenals, leading to higher defense budgets dedicated to missile technology. Countries seek to modernize their military capabilities, which directly boosts demand for missile warheads. This heightened focus on national security and deterrence strategies sustains market growth, especially in regions with ongoing conflicts or rising tensions. Defense spending trends directly correlate with market expansion, making geopolitical stability a critical factor.
  • International Treaties and Export Controls: Regulatory frameworks such as the Missile Technology Control Regime (MTCR) influence market dynamics by restricting or enabling the transfer of missile technology and warheads. These treaties aim to prevent proliferation but can also limit market access for certain countries or companies. Compliance requirements and export restrictions shape the competitive landscape, impacting global trade and collaboration. Navigating these regulations is crucial for market participants seeking to expand their reach while adhering to international standards.
  • Defense Budget Allocations: Government defense budgets significantly impact the market by determining the level of investment in missile technology and warhead development. Increased allocations facilitate research, procurement, and modernization efforts, fueling market growth. Conversely, budget constraints or reallocations can hinder development projects and slow market expansion. Strategic priorities and political stability influence budget decisions, making them a vital driver for industry players.
  • Technological Collaboration and Partnerships: Strategic alliances between defense contractors, research institutions, and governments accelerate innovation and reduce development costs. Collaborative efforts enable the sharing of expertise, resources, and technology, fostering the creation of advanced missile warheads. These partnerships also help navigate regulatory complexities and expand market access. As collaboration becomes more prevalent, it drives faster innovation cycles and broadens the scope of market opportunities.

The challenges facing the missile warhead market include:

  • Regulatory and Compliance Barriers: Strict international regulations and export controls pose significant hurdles for market participants. Compliance with treaties like the MTCR and national security laws requires extensive documentation and adherence to complex procedures, which can delay product development and deployment. These barriers limit market flexibility and can restrict access to certain regions or customers, impacting growth prospects. Navigating regulatory landscapes demands substantial resources and expertise, often increasing costs and operational risks.
  • Ethical and Political Concerns: The development and proliferation of missile warheads raise ethical questions and political sensitivities. Concerns over arms races, regional stability, and humanitarian impacts influence public opinion and government policies. These issues can lead to restrictions, sanctions, or diplomatic pressures that hinder market expansion. Balancing strategic defense needs with ethical considerations remains a persistent challenge for industry stakeholders.
  • Technological Arms Race and Obsolescence: Rapid technological advancements can lead to an arms race, prompting countries to continuously upgrade their missile arsenals. This cycle of innovation can result in obsolescence of existing warheads, requiring ongoing R&D investments. The high costs associated with maintaining technological superiority pose financial challenges, especially for emerging markets. Additionally, the risk of technological proliferation increases, complicating efforts to control and secure missile technology globally.

The missile warhead market is shaped by a dynamic mix of technological progress, geopolitical factors, and regulatory frameworks. While innovation and defense spending drive growth, regulatory hurdles and ethical concerns present significant challenges. Strategic collaborations foster advancements but require navigating complex legal landscapes. Overall, these drivers and challenges influence the markets trajectory, demanding adaptive strategies from industry players to capitalize on opportunities while managing risks. The evolving geopolitical environment and technological landscape will continue to define the future of missile warhead development and deployment.

Country Wise Outlook for the Missile Warhead Market

The missile warhead market has experienced significant shifts driven by technological advancements, geopolitical tensions, and evolving defense strategies across the globe. Countries are investing heavily in research and development to enhance missile accuracy, payload capacity, and survivability. The market is also witnessing increased collaboration between nations and private firms to develop next-generation warheads. These developments reflect the growing importance of missile technology in national security and defense postures. As regional conflicts and international rivalries intensify, the demand for advanced missile warheads continues to rise, prompting innovation and strategic realignments worldwide.

  • United States: The US has made substantial progress in developing hypersonic missile warheads, focusing on speed and maneuverability. Recent advancements include the deployment of new missile defense systems and increased funding for research into miniaturized, high-precision warheads. The US also emphasizes upgrading existing missile platforms to improve reliability and range, with collaborations between government agencies and private defense contractors driving innovation.
  • China: China has accelerated its missile warhead development, emphasizing both strategic and tactical capabilities. Recent developments include the testing of advanced hypersonic glide vehicles and improvements in missile accuracy. The country is also expanding its missile arsenal, integrating new warhead designs that enhance payload versatility and survivability, reflecting its goal to modernize its military forces rapidly.
  • Germany: Germany continues to focus on missile defense and precision-guided warheads within NATO frameworks. Recent advancements involve integrating advanced guidance systems and developing modular warhead designs for flexibility across different missile platforms. Germany is also investing in research to improve the safety and environmental impact of missile warheads, aligning with broader European defense initiatives.
  • India: India has made notable progress in indigenous missile warhead technology, emphasizing long-range and high-precision capabilities. Recent developments include the successful testing of new missile systems with advanced warheads capable of carrying multiple types of payloads. India is also working on enhancing the survivability and accuracy of its missile arsenal to counter regional threats effectively.
  • Japan: Japan is advancing its missile warhead technology primarily for self-defense, focusing on precision and reliability. Recent developments include the deployment of new missile systems with improved warhead accuracy and the integration of advanced targeting systems. Japan is also exploring missile defense collaborations with allied nations to bolster its strategic capabilities amid regional tensions.
